Difficult one - I don't like them right outside the house, and I hate the unnecessary booing. It's fine when the HMs deserve it, but half the time they really don't and so often the mob are out of touch with the general opinion of viewers.
If they remained they should be moved back towards the studio (like in BB4). Personally I think they could do without for general evictions - I quite liked the set up in Celeb BB2 with a small crowd in the studio, but they could still be heard in the background as the evictee left the house. If axed from evictions though, they should be kept for the launch and finale. The other alternative is to ditch the outdoor crowd and have a large studio audience instead. It depends though how that's set up whether it would be successful - I wouldn't want a traditional TV audience set up, it needs to be more informal. I have opted for no crowd though - the evictions desperately need something different, and ditching the crowd forces a change. "Studio Davina" is also a much, much better presenter than "middle of the mob Davina". |
